I think it honestly will be closer to 15k private party just looking at retail listings around Chicago.  The last couple years have not been kind to SHO resale value.
 
I just sold my 2011 non pp with nav, 401a pkg, sunroof and contour seats with 81k for 14,250. That with me transferring the Ford Premium Care balance to the new owner that covers to 100k.
 
Yea prices in Northern Virginia are a bit inflated... Here a 2011 with 100K+miles for 16K at a 3rd rate dealer..One step above chop shop... The next is a 2013 with 80k+ miles for 18K...
